Output 3311acc27c3af7f79eb98619509c1a59f8cc9a0a4f70907d2402f2e1adc139d1:45

value
13404000
script pubkey
OP_0 OP_PUSHBYTES_20 bbafe2dfedda2b3e58b89975d62bbe41ddbebe95
address
ltc1qhwh79hldmg4nuk9cn96av2a7g8wma05453w4uq
transaction
3311acc27c3af7f79eb98619509c1a59f8cc9a0a4f70907d2402f2e1adc139d1
spent
true